Chancellor: We will get Britain building again
Chancellor Rachel Reeves has announced plans to get "Britain building again" by unlocking the planning system. The first female chancellor said there were tough decisions to be taken but that the Labour government would "get things done" and prioritise growth, while her department makes assessments of the economy left by the Conservatives.
